Zero-variate data
| Data | Observed | Predicted | (RE) | Unit | Description | Reference |
|---|---|---|---|---|---|---|
| ab | 7 | 7.04 | (0.005651) | d | age at birth | guess |
| am | 365 | 365.1 | (0.0002727) | d | life span | fishbase |
| Lp | 9.3 | 9.256 | (0.004738) | cm | std length at puberty | KabiHoss1998 |
| Lpm | 7.7 | 7.474 | (0.02933) | cm | std length at puberty for males | KabiHoss1998 |
| Li | 20 | 20.07 | (0.003448) | cm | ultimate total length | fishbase |
| Wwb | 0.00052 | 0.0005177 | (0.004419) | g | wet weight at birth | KabiHoss1998 |
| Wwp | 14.65 | 14.04 | (0.04182) | g | wet weight at puberty | KabiHoss1998 |
| Wwpm | 7.41 | 7.421 | (0.001512) | g | wet weight at puberty for males | KabiHoss1998 |
| Wwi | 82.8 | 143.1 | (0.7281) | g | ultimate wet weight | fishbase |

Discussion
- males are assumed to differ from females by {p_Am} and E_Hp only
- calculated Wwi was ignored, due to inconsistency with tW data
Facts
- length-weight: Ww in g = 0.00891*(TL in cm)^3.05 (Ref: fishbase)
